For his third feature outing, director
Sydney Pollack helmed this comedic western starring (
Burt Lancaster) as fur trapper
Joe Bass. While heading for the trading post for his pay after a successful hunting season,
Bass runs into a band of Kiowa Indians, who offer to trade the educated slave
Joseph (
Ozzie Davis) for
Bass's furs. Severely outnumbered, the uneducated
Bass reluctantly agrees to the swap at gunpoint.
Bass and
Joseph then follow the Indians in hopes of retrieving the furs. Along the way, the Indians meet up with
Jim Howie (
Telly Savalas), who not only steals the furs from the Indians, but
Joseph from
Bass. From there,
Jim and his mistress
Kate (
Shelley Winters) head for Mexico, a move that is fine with
Joseph because slavery is outlawed there. But they may not make it south of the border, as the Indians have regrouped and are on their trail with plans to take back the furs.
~ Matthew Tobey, All Movie Guide
